The short answer
Shamrock Farms averages 88.8/100 across the 40 of 96 tracked products that carry an ingredient list, and 72.5% of those contain at least one separately flagged ingredient. The figure summarizes Open Food Facts labels cross-referenced with FDA SAFFA and CSPI; it does not establish recall status, allergy suitability, or the composition of products outside this snapshot.

Catalog evidence
Ingredient-list coverage comes before the score
Only 40 of 96 tracked Shamrock Farms records (41.7%) include an ingredient list. The remaining 56 cannot be screened, so the 88.8/100 mean describes the labelled subset rather than the whole brand.

Processing mix (NOVA)
Shamrock Farms processing intensity
Shamrock Farms's NOVA-classified set is 39 products: 76.9% ultra-processed (Group 4, 30 items) with Group 4 (ultra-processed) largest at 30. That ultra-processed share sits 1.4 points below the 78.3% median for 1,323 brands with 50+ products. NOVA is processing intensity, not additive safety.

Shamrock Farms relies most on Carrageenan, an industry staple
Across the 40 Shamrock Farms products scored here, Carrageenan appears in 28. It is used by 2,390 other brands in this database (6.8% of them), so its presence says more about the category than about this brand. A flag records that a named source raised a concern about an ingredient. It is not a finding that a product is unsafe to eat.
| Flagged ingredient | Shamrock Farms products | Why it is flagged |
|---|---|---|
| Carrageenan | 28 | Concern recorded by a review body; no ban cited |
| Sucralose | 16 | Concern recorded by a review body; no ban cited |
| Caramel Coloring | 3 | Restricted: California (Prop 65 warning for 4-MEI) |
| Red 40 | 2 | FDA voluntary phase-out target 2027-12-31 (a request, not a ban) · Restricted: California (schools) |
| Polysorbate 80 | 1 | Concern recorded by a review body; no ban cited |
Counts are products in this database whose ingredient list names the flagged ingredient. Flags come from FDA enforcement actions, CSPI Chemical Cuisine ratings and US state ingredient laws; see the methodology for how each source is applied.
